‘You Don’t Know How To Act In Public!’: Fiery Waiting-Room Showdown Erupts After Man Blasts Music Without Headphones In Doctor’s Office

schedule 28 days ago visibility 5,521 views
A tense confrontation in a doctor’s office waiting room has gone viral, capturing raw public frustration over basic etiquette, as a woman blasted a middle-aged man for playing loud music on his phone without headphones, only for him to fire back with a threat to have her beaten up.

The clip, shared Tuesday by Right Angle News and racking up over a million views in hours, shows the heated exchange unfolding in what appears to be a standard medical clinic waiting area with blue couches and health insurance posters.

“You don’t know how to act in public. You’re like 50 years old,” the woman tells the man, according to the video and accompanying text. Other patients sit silently as the awkward scene plays out, with no staff intervening.

The man, dressed casually, doesn’t back down. He escalates quickly, threatening to call his girlfriend to “beat her up,” witnesses and the post describe.

The woman who recorded it later explained she was there with her oldest brother for his appointment when the disruption started. The video shows her seated, gesturing and recounting the blow-up, with on-screen text overlay: “took my oldest brother to his Dr appointment, and this is what happened....”

The video highlights ongoing debates about declining public decorum, with many pointing out that waiting rooms, planes, and public transit have become battlegrounds for basic respect. Headphones exist for a reason, but apparently not everyone got the memo.

No arrests or further details on the individuals involved have emerged, but the clip has sparked a firestorm online, with users split between backing the fed-up woman and cautioning against direct confrontations that could turn dangerous.
